The datasheet typically covers a range of critical information, often presented in a structured format. You'll find details on:
- Physical specifications (dimensions, weight, power consumption).
- Performance metrics (throughput, latency).
- Available interfaces (Gigabit Ethernet, SFP ports, console ports).
- Supported wireless technologies (Wi-Fi 5, Wi-Fi 6).
- Security features (firewall, VPN, intrusion prevention).
- Quality of Service (QoS) capabilities.
- Power supply options.
